Olympus E-3 DSLR Unveiled

Olympus has officially released it’s E-1 DSLR successor, the E-3. The digicam will have a live view LCD, work on the 3/4ths mount standard, and be available at least somewhere in November. Additionally, it has a 10MP sensor, 11 point auto focus, etc. Stay tuned for more updates.
